Industrial Building Painting in Waco, TX
Industrial building painting services involve applying protective and aesthetic coatings to large-scale structures such as warehouses, manufacturing facilities, storage tanks, and other commercial properties. These projects typically require specialized equipment and techniques to ensure even coverage on expansive surfaces, often involving high-performance paints designed to withstand harsh environmental conditions. Property owners considering these services usually want to understand the scope of the work, including surface preparation, types of coatings used, and the durability of the finish to ensure long-lasting protection and appearance.
Before requesting industrial building painting, property owners should consider factors such as the specific surfaces to be painted, the existing condition of the structure, and any environmental or safety regulations that may apply. It is also helpful to clarify whether the project involves interior or exterior surfaces, as different coatings and preparation methods may be required. Understanding these details can help ensure the chosen services meet the needs of the property, providing a durable and visually appealing result.

Common Industrial Building Painting Jobs
Industrial Building Exterior Painting - enhances curb appeal and protects structural surfaces from weather damage.
Warehouse Painting - improves visibility and safety with clear, durable coatings for large interior and exterior spaces.
Manufacturing Facility Painting - maintains a professional appearance while safeguarding against corrosion and wear.
Storage Tank Painting - prevents rust and leaks on large tanks used for industrial storage needs.
Loading Dock and Facility Painting - provides slip-resistant and weather-resistant finishes for high-traffic areas.
Industrial Roof Coatings - extends roof lifespan and reduces energy costs with protective, reflective finishes.
Industrial Building Painting Questions
What types of industrial buildings can be painted? Industrial painting services typically cover warehouses, factories, manufacturing plants, and storage facilities to improve appearance and protection.
Why is surface preparation important before painting? Proper surface prep ensures paint adhesion, prevents peeling, and extends the lifespan of the coating on industrial surfaces.
What finishes are available for industrial painting projects? Options include matte, gloss, and semi-gloss finishes, depending on the desired durability and appearance for the building.
How often should industrial building exteriors be repainted? Repainting frequency depends on the building's exposure and condition but generally ranges from 5 to 10 years for optimal maintenance.
